As election day draws near, it's time to focus on the candidates and issues that matter to agriculture in Michigan.

From Michigan Farm Bureau's grassroots, member-driven policy process to the work of AgriPac, member participation is critical to fulfilling the organizational mission. Check out the messages below from Michigan Farm Bureau President Carl Bednarski to help you prepare for the upcoming elections.
